This is gonna be long! :D

I hated when B&B was under Kay Alden's helm during the strike. Everything was so dark, and the cast was sparingly used. She had no grasp on the characters or the style of the show itself. At the moment, things have changed, and not for the better. What is happening isn't actually bad in small doses. I.e Pam's antics, Tiny's death, Rick & Taylor, Eric & Donna - in a different context, these stories would work, but as they are, they suck.

For me, Pam needs more of a direction; more motive. I'm actually feeling for Donna, who is being victimized by a crazy woman, and know one seems to believe her. How many wack jobs has this show had? Too many! So why is Eric brushing Donna's concerns to one side? I liked it when Pam had a crush on Eric, but now, that's faded, and I'm not really sure why she's tormenting Donna. And Stephanie is just left gasping in utter shock at Pam's antics. "I switched Eric's magic pills." "OMG! You switched his vi... OMG!" Stephanie needs to be more pro-active. It doesn't even seem like her fight. As for Eric, he just looks a complete fool.

I like the idea of Rick & Taylor - they make a hot couple. I just don't like this Taylor. This is *so* out of character for her. Whatever happened to her morals, and that holier-than-thou attitude that used to grate at times, but now is sorely missing. Taylor would never have been so easily seduced into acting like Brooke. She needs to call time on it. How about Taylor and Storm? (He'd ditch the homicidal tendencies)

It's interesting reading people's ideas, and what they'd like to happen - not all are on the top of my list... but hey.

For me, BB needs to allow Brooke to grow and mature. Her character is in a major rut, which puts the show into a rut. If she could just choose between Ridge and Nick (or neither) and just stick to it for at least a year, then things would improve. The constant flickering from Ridge and Nick has zero depth, and doesn't make the audience care. It just shakes us about, until we chuck-up.

I would have a triangle between Brooke/Ridge/Ashley, which would see Ridge turn to Ash. Not a full blown affair, just a connection, a bond that has them sharing time. This would be the catalyst that sends Brooke on a spiritual quest, where she'd embark on proper reflection. She'd return, ending it with Ridge. Brooke desperately needs to learn to be independent, and not be so needy. Only then can she have a grown up relationship, who may-or-may-not be with Ridge. I don't like the idea of Ridge & Ashley being a happy couple - this normally means back-burner status.

The gay character is a nice idea, but I'd settle for *any* kind of diversity. I totally love the idea of bi CJ - and it doesn't have to be a snoozefest if done right, Sylph. I also think Felicia is perfect bi material. Either way, shove both characters together. Felicia could maybe misconstrue the signals with Ashley, and kiss her. It would linger of course. It could add a whole new dynamic to her and Ridge's relationship. With Fifi, I think she'd be pretty comfortable with herself. CJ though, I can imagine being less confident.

The fashion aspect needs to return, pronto; and the cast needs to be utilized more. I'd love to see Jackie and Clarke get together - more casual than serious, though. CJ could work for them (as well as running Insomnia), and Tony and Kristen could return to Spectra, and she could be secretly pregnant - how controversial!

Thorne is in desperate need of a story. Seeing as the Forrester's are meant to be high profile, I'd have him meet a new girl (con artist), who'd be out to exploit him for all he's got. She'd set-up a hidden camera in Thorne's house, handing the tapes over to some shady guy, in exchange for money. She'd be a hit with his family, including Katie, who would develop a thing for Thorne. What the tapes are for, and why she needs cash would be a mystery.

I also think a new take on the directing would improve B&B's look. And the opening is too dull for B&B - needs more colour (in every sense of the word).
